instill
英 [ɪnˈstɪl]
美 [ɪnˈstɪl]
v. 浸染;逐渐灌输;滴注(入,下)
第三人称单数:instills 现在分词:instilling 过去式:instilled 过去分词:instilled
BNC.34201 / COCA.12013
英英释义
verb
- fill, as with a certain quality
- The heavy traffic tinctures the air with carbon monoxide
- teach and impress by frequent repetitions or admonitions
- inculcate values into the young generation
- produce or try to produce a vivid impression of
- Mother tried to ingrain respect for our elders in us
- enter drop by drop
- instill medication into my eye
- impart gradually
- Her presence instilled faith into the children
- transfuse love of music into the students
